-Templo Branco (Wat Rong Khun) é um dos templos mais bonitos (e estranhos) da Tailândia. Por que o Templo Branco é famoso? O templo foi projetado e construído por um artista local e é conhecido por sua arquitetura única e marcante. O exterior do templo é inteiramente branco e coberto por intrincados trabalhos de espelho, dando-lhe uma aparência etérea e deslumbrante. Definitivamente vale a pena uma visita.
-Blue Temple é um templo budista que se destaca dos demais pela sua cor azul safira. O templo é extraordinariamente belo com suas artes aplicadas únicas usando um tom de azul e beleza arquitetônica de um artista de estuque.
- Wat Huay Pla Kang é o complexo de museus do templo com um pagode de 9 andares com 12 estruturas ao redor e um Buda gigante.
